Choosing the Right Type of Window Hinges

Replacement-Windows-150x150.jpgThe type of hinges you choose for your windows will affect their function as well as their durability and aesthetics. Stainless steel friction stays are durable and have a long life duration. They also resist corrosion.

These hinges also provide ventilation control, which can help reduce energy consumption. There are many types of friction stays hinges, including regular, restricted and simple clean.

uPVC window restricted child safety hinges

uPVC window restricted hinges for children are a simple but effective method to increase the security of your windows. They come with a built-in restriction that prevents your window from opening too much which can cause injuries or damage to your property. These hinges are suitable to fit a variety of windows and are easily installed over standard uPVC hinges. uPVC window restrictor hinges are compatible with side-hung and top hung windows, and they are suitable for a range of frame thicknesses.

These uPVC hinges are made to ensure high-end performance and quality, and they come with all the required hardware to ensure that your window is secure. They are compatible with the majority of kinds of windows and are constructed from corrosion-resistant materials. They are also easy to maintain, requiring only occasional cleaning and oiling. They also offer a wide range of benefits, including smooth operation, controlled venting and security features.

Standard window hinges made of uPVC.

Window hinges play a significant part in the overall performance and durability of uPVC windows. They allow for safe opening and shutting of windows, while providing flexibility and ease of maintenance. They also help reduce drafts and heat loss by creating an enclosure between the frame and the door. They are also resistant to corrosion and easy to install by anyone, regardless of specialized technical skills.

The kind of hinges you choose will depend on the window location and sash size. Standard friction-stay hinges are designed for top-hung and side-hung windows. They allow windows to be opened up to an average angle. They are available in a variety of sizes and finishes. However, choosing the best hinge for your window requires careful analysis. Think about the size and weight your sash, as well as what you need for ventilation and views. Also, you should think about the height of your stack and the length of your hinges, since these could have an impact on how to fix a window hinge far you can open your window.

Fire escape hinges are another type of uPVC hinges that provide a larger opening to permit an emergency escape. These hinges are available in various sizes and styles, and can be fitted to both uPVC flush and stormproof casement windows. The hinge that is restricted to children can be used on both uPVC side hung windows as well as uPVC top hung windows. This hinge stops the sash from opening too far and has a locking button to prevent accidents.

Window hinges that are easy to clean are also available for both side and top-hung windows. These hinges are suitable for multi-storey buildings, and come with a sliding mechanism that makes it easier to clean hard-to-reach windows. Although they can be more difficult to operate than conventional hinges, they are an excellent choice for windows with high heights in multi-storey buildings.
